EYFS

At Oakley Cross, our first aim is to welcome the children into a warm, friendly and supportive environment in which they can learn, play and develop their personalities and talents.

We have high expectations for all children and aim for them to be happy, achieve their potential and have the best possible start in life.

Our Curriculum starts in Early Years. Teaching themes are based around chosen core texts which engage children and give opportunities to learn through curiosity and play.

Should you require a nursery place for your child, please do not hesitate to contact the school.  You can arrange to visit, have a look at our setting and ask any questions you may have.

Nursery admissions are made directly to our school and not through the Local Authority.

We will provide nursery education for children from the age of 2 years.  Parents must meet eligibility criteria to access one of these places for free.  We also offer additional paid sessions on request and subject to space in nursery.  For more information contact the school.

Blossom Class

Our Reception class at Oakley Cross is called Blossom class. This is our first year at school and it is where our personalities, interests, knowledge and understanding can blossom.

Throughout their time in Blossom class, children will experience a wide range of activities and opportunities that will enable them to become life long learners and achieve our ‘Oakley Outcomes’. Take a look at out Reception Oakley Outcomes Below:
